实时分析数据库 Druid,Mark 一下 持之以恒,贵在坚持,每天进步一点点! 前言 Druid 则是一个分布式的支持实时分析的数据存储系统(Data Store)。Druid 设计之初的想法就是为分析而生,它在处理数据的规模、数据处理的实时性方面,比传统的 OLAP 系统有了显著的性能改进,而且拥抱主流的开源生态,包括 Hadoop 等。多年...
原生数据结构,如 Geo 和 Sorted Sets,以及处理 JSON、Graph 和其他数据的模块,有助于加快基于位置、时间、关系和其他参数的分析。 Redis 处理高速事务(读取与写入一致)的能力,以及使用其列表数据结构进行作业和队列管理以及使用其Hash数据结构快速更新用户会话数据的能力,使其成为在线欺诈检测的通用选择,其中应用程序延迟...
Druid 是一个实时分析型的数据库,用于大规模实时数据导入、快速查询分析的场景,包括网站访问点击流分析、网络性能监控分析、应用性能指标存储与分析、供应链分析、广告分析等。 Druid 的核心集成了数据仓库、时序数据库、日志搜索系统的设计,主要包含如下特性: 列式存储:Druid 使用列存方式组织数据,访问时可按需加载访问...
Apache Doris是一个基于MPP架构的高性能实时分析数据库,以其极快的速度和易于使用而闻名。在海量数据下返回查询结果只需亚秒级的响应时间,不仅支持高并发点查询场景,还支持高吞吐量复杂分析场景。基于此,Apache Doris可以更好地满足报表分析、自定义查询、统一数据仓库、数据湖查询加速等场景。用户可以在此基础上构建用...
Druid 是一个高性能的实时分析数据库。它在 PB 级数据处理、毫秒级查询、数据实时处理方面,比传统的 OLAP 系统有显著的性能提升。Druid 的官方网站是 http://druid.io Druid 的三个设计原则 快速查询(Fast Query):部分数据的聚合(Partial Aggregate)+内存化(In-emory)+索引(Index)。水平扩展能力(...
下面将从下面2个部分介绍Apache Doris(实时的分析型数据)Doris定位:即 Doris所要面临的业务场景及解决的问题;产品定位:MPP 架构的关系型分析数据库;PB 级别大数据集,秒级/毫秒级查询;主要用于多维分析和报表查询;2018年进入 Apache 孵化器;数据分析中的定位:Doris关键技术 Doris整体架构,如下图:Doris主要...
Doris(原百度Palo)是一款基于大规模并行处理技术的分布式 SQL 数据库,由百度在2017年开源,2018年8月进入Apache孵化器。Apache Doris被数百家企业应用在生产系统,包含美团、京东、小米、字节、华为、腾讯等公司。 2022年1月由 Apache Doris 创始团队和百度智能云创始团队创立的飞轮科技(SelectDB),总部位于北京,并在西安...
众所周知,数据库是用来储存数据的。实时数据库中的每个数据都是跟时间相关的,是时间序列的数据,工业现场的压力值、温度值、流量值,离开时间那么这个数据就毫无意义,比如说温度是25度,这个数据在工业现场是没有实质意义的,要把时间关联上,要说2024年8月26日中午12点的温度是25度。 实时数据库的优势分析: 快速响应...
TeleDB基于无共享架构,通过引入分布式执行引擎和全局事务管理器,实现了完整ACID特性,在满足交易型业务的同时也能支持复杂查询。为了进一步提升分析型业务的处理能力,我们引入了列式存储和向量化引擎,同时整合RDA、实时写入、实时查询等技术,实现海量数据的实时入库、实时分析。在第15届中国数据库技术大会(DTCC2024)...
Apache Druid 是一个高性能的实时分析型数据库。 一个现代化的云原生,流原生,分析型数据库 Druid 是为快速查询和快速摄入数据的工作流而设计的。Druid 强在有强大的 UI,运行时可操作查询,和高性能并发处理。Druid 可以被视为一个满足多样化用户场景的数据仓库的开源替代品。